One more tip for newbies (which, er, I just figured out yesterday, so it's not like I'm a pro at this): Mastodon has a "lists" feature, so (for example) I created a list of journalists, and then I can just open that list and see what all the journalists are talking about.

Next working on lists for law, policy, and academia.

And in the advanced webview, I can set up all those columns next to each other.

It's... nice.
